117 GENERAL ACCESS SCAFFOLDING AND WORKING PLATFORMS The Contractor is to comply with all current Health and Safety

Regulations relating to the Work at Height(Amendment) Regulations 2007. The Contractor is to provide, erect and maintain all necessary access scaffolding including stairs and other safe working platforms for the proper execution of the works, including moving, adapting as necessary during the course of the works, dismantling and removal on completion. All scaffolding work including erection, alterations and dismantling is to be carried out by qualified scaffolding operatives. All working platforms must be capable of supporting the intended loads, adequately supported and braced, and provided with guard rails or barriers and toe boards. All scaffolding must be erected with legs/standards vertical, suitably protected and bearing on firm level ground using base plates, or on spreader boards without causing a trip hazard.

Tower scaffolds and other proprietary scaffold systems must be erected, used and dismantled in accordance with manufacturer’s instructions. Mobile towers must have all wheels and outriggers locked and never be moved whilst in use or when loaded with materials. Only use internal ladders to access tower scaffolds, do not climb up the outside of the tower to reach the platform

Provide safe access to all scaffold / working platforms. Ladders are to

be adequately tied to prevent slipping, correctly angled (75 degrees, i.e.1 out of every 4 up), and extend 1m above the working platform

Inspections of scaffolding / working platforms are to be carried out by a

competent person at maximum 7 day intervals and recorded in an Inspection Report where applicable.

Should the Contractor remove any of his scaffolding / working

platforms before ascertaining whether it is required by any sub-contractor he must re-erect it if required at his own expense.

All standards are to be sheathed and/or protected throughout and

visually identifiable.

CABLE INSTALLATION: Plan and install all fire detection and alarm system cables in accordance with BS 5839-1: 2017 and the cable manufacturer's recommendations.

Run cables point to point without tees or spurs. Design loop load to not exceed 80% of cable capacity.

Where cables are not supported continuously due to the method of installation, they shall be supported by suitable means at appropriate intervals in such a manner that the conductor or cables do not suffer damage by their own weight.

2.12

Every cable or conductor shall be supported in such a way that it is not exposed to undue mechanical stain and so that there is no appreciable mechanical strain on the terminals of the conductors, account being taken of mechanical stain imposed by the supported weight of the cable or conductor itself and in accordance with BS 7671:2011 +A3:2015. Therefore they will be metal clipped at 300mm centres on the horizontal and 400mm on the vertical and fixed with fire resistant fixings and segregated from other cables except where crossing over other cables, to reduce risk of electromagnetic field interference, strictly in compliance with BS 5839-1:2017. Wiring systems in escape routes shall be supported such that they will not be liable to premature collapse in the event of fire. The requirement of the electrical wiring regulations 422.2.1 BS 7671 shall also apply, irrespective of the classification of the conditions for the condition for evacuation in an emergency. All cables will be fire resistant when tested in accordance with BS EN 50200 for loops with red LSOH outer sheath with a minimum 30 minute survival time. Enhanced fire resistant wiring of 120 minutes duration is to be supplied and installed for all interconnecting network cables due to the fact that the building has no sprinkler system. No joints are permitted within the underground duct system for the network cables and all joints above ground on network cables are to be kept to the minimum, marked on plan and located in easily accessible locations. All surface run cables to walls and ceilings that cannot be run within voids are to be contained within round ridged galvanised steel surface conduit diameter to suit size and number of cables, complete and fittings e.g clips, bends, termination boxes etc. and be left in an undecorated condition. The contractor is to allow to adhere to the procedures as detailed in the School’s insurer Zurich Municipal’s Hot Work Permit if hot works are considered necessary. The emphasis is to employ less hazardous methods that avoid hot work. This is to comprise a work assessment and specific work method statements and completion of the relevant Zurich two page permit detailing the location and the work involved and the precautions to be taken for each time angle grinders, hot air guns or hot air strippers, blowlamps, cutting and welding or other heat producing equipment or materials are used. Adequate notice for the CA to notify Zurich and programming of the work is essential. The contractor is to allow for the appropriate fire watch inspections 30 and 60 minutes after work has been completed and found to be firesafe as the final check-up procedure and the permit signed off by the supervisor inspecting, with the permit filed for review by the Insurer’s Surveyor. The flat roof consists of a timber structure supported by and infilled between 225x100 mm RSJ's @ 2440mm c/c that supports the original tonkin deck, plywood and woodwool slab flat roof decking, insulation and bituminous roofing felt covering. The roof structure within the average 500mm deep flat roof void comprises 125x38mm ceiling joists @ 600mm c/c (that supported previously removed fibreboard ceilings), 150x38mm intermediate joists @ 1250mm c/c, 75x38mm joists @ 600mmc/c which supports the roof decking with 50x50mm noggings to decking and original ceiling. A section of the original fibreboard ceiling exists to the corridor area 0/084 outside of science classrooms S3 and S4, which an asbestos analysis has indicated as having no asbestos content. The roof structure comprises a timber infill of rafters between a steel supporting structure with no ceiling joists. Access is limited through two access points to each block through the suspended ceiling tiles which access the cold water storage tanks via a very limited boarded area with some mains lighting provided. Block 2 has a loft ladder provided and block 10 is via ladder access only. The majority of the roof voids have no walkway and areas can only be accessed through the suspended ceiling.
